CMS 3D CMS Logo

/data/refman/pasoursint/CMSSW_5_2_9/src/DQM/SiStripMonitorClient/python/SiStripDQMOffline_cff.py

Go to the documentation of this file.
00001 import FWCore.ParameterSet.Config as cms
00002 
00003 # DQM services
00004 DQMStore = cms.Service("DQMStore",
00005     referenceFileName = cms.untracked.string(''),
00006     verbose = cms.untracked.int32(0)
00007 )
00008 
00009 #  DQM Online Environment #####
00010 # use include file for dqmEnv dqmSaver
00011 from DQMServices.Components.DQMEnvironment_cfi import *
00012 dqmSaver.convention = 'Online'
00013 dqmSaver.dirName       = "."
00014 dqmSaver.producer = 'DQM'
00015 dqmEnv.subSystemFolder = 'SiStrip'
00016 dqmSaver.saveByRun = 1
00017 dqmSaver.saveAtJobEnd = False
00018 
00019 # Quality Tester ####
00020 qTester = cms.EDAnalyzer("QualityTester",
00021     qtList = cms.untracked.FileInPath('DQM/SiStripMonitorClient/data/sistrip_qualitytest_config.xml'),
00022     prescaleFactor = cms.untracked.int32(1),
00023     getQualityTestsFromFile = cms.untracked.bool(True)
00024 )
00025 
00026 # STRIP DQM Source and Client
00027 from DQM.SiStripMonitorClient.SiStripSourceConfig_cff import *
00028 from DQM.SiStripMonitorClient.SiStripClientConfig_cff import *
00029 
00030 SiStripDQMOffSimData = cms.Sequence(SiStripSourcesSimData*qTester*SiStripOfflineDQMClient*dqmEnv*dqmSaver)
00031 SiStripDQMOffRealData = cms.Sequence(SiStripSourcesRealData*qTester*SiStripOfflineDQMClient*dqmEnv*dqmSaver)
00032 SiStripDQMOffRealDataCollision = cms.Sequence(SiStripSourcesRealDataCollision*qTester*SiStripOfflineDQMClient*dqmEnv*dqmSaver)